What is the job all about? My main task is to work in partnership with education, social services, youth offending teams, crime- and disorder-reduction partnerships and other groups to look at youth provision and help manage the process. I don't have face-to-face input with young people, but our personal adviser programme works with around 70 young people who are at risk of crime. We have links with 26 voluntary organisations that we partly fund, including the youth service, social services, education, crime- and disorder-reduction partnerships.
We put on a range of activities for young people, including arts projects, outdoor activities, power boating and anti-crime workshops.
